Barcelona (ver plano) SOS Galgos joined together to celebrate the Greyhound Planet day in rememberance to all the greyhounds and galgos that are suffering around the world. Over 50 rescued galgos met up with their adopters and friends, in the Paseo de Potosí, in front of the Maquinista shopping mall on the afternoon of Saturday September 24th. Together, we walked with our galgos along the Besos river, which separates and unites both the city of Barcelona and the town of Santa Coloma, both of which still allow the exploitation and overcrowding of 700 greyhounds in conditions that do not abide by laws for the protection of animals. In memory of all the greyhounds and galgos that weren't there with us, whose fate was and still is to be used and abused and taken advantage of, SOS Galgos' president, Anna Clements, gave a small speech to those present to pay tribute to the many that in Barcelona and lots of other parts of Spain continue to suffer. We each let a balloon go, watching them disappear in the sky in honour of all the greyhouds and galgos and to say that they have rights and we shall be their voices.
